Tender Skillet Chicken with Bell Peppers, Onions, and Tomatoes
Enjoy a vibrant, one-skillet meal featuring succulent chicken breast sautéed with crisp bell peppers, tender onions, and juicy tomatoes. Enhanced with a light olive oil finish, this dish is both flavorful and satisfying, perfectly balancing lean protein with fresh vegetables for a wholesome, delicious meal.
INGREDIENTS
6 oz Chicken Breast
1 cup Bell Peppers (sliced)
1/2 medium Onion (sliced)
1 medium Tomato (diced)
2 tsp Olive Oil
PREPARATION
Pat the chicken breast dry and season lightly with salt and pepper or your preferred seasoning.
Heat a skillet over medium heat and add 2 teaspoons of olive oil.
Sauté the sliced onions in the hot oil until they begin to soften, about 2 minutes.
Add the bell peppers and cook for an additional 2 minutes until slightly tender.
Place the chicken breast in the skillet and cook for about 5-6 minutes on one side until browned.
Flip the chicken and add the diced tomato to the pan, allowing the tomato juices to meld with the vegetables.
Continue cooking for another 5-6 minutes until the chicken is fully cooked and the vegetables are tender.
Remove from heat, slice the chicken if desired, and serve immediately.
